2-Hour TN Massage Law Class for Establishment Owners was created as the board requires all owners who are not licensed massage therapist to take a 2-Hour TN Massage Law Class once every two years.  If you are already a TN LMT, you need the TN Massage Law and Ethics class.

CE Credits: 2 Hours 

Cost: $200.00 

A copy of the current Tennessee Massage Board Rules, Regulations & Policies will be provided.

General review of all rules and regulations with emphasis on:

  1. Practice standards and inspections of establishment
  2. Necessity of Licensure
  3. Establishment licensure process
  4. Licensure renewal
  5. Retirement, Reinstatement, Inactivation and reactivation of licensure
  6. Continuing Education
  7. Disciplinary actions and civil penalties
  8. License/Establishment address and name
  9. Advertising
  10. Consumer Right-To-Know requirements
  11. Professional and ethical standards 

Clarification and current standards will be reviewed.

Japanese Facial Massage is a unique method that focuses on a blend of the aesthetic and physiological treating the whole client. The treatment goes beyond Swedish massage and concentrates on opening up the acupuncture meridians that energize the face, head and shoulders to achieve a balancing and grounding effect.

The focus is on:

  1. Increasing the flow of oxygen and blood to the facial area, neck and shoulders
  2. Toning/tightening the skin and fascia
  3. Lymphatic drainage and detoxification of skin and organ systems
  4. Better mental alertness, focus and relaxation for the client
  5. Emotional cleansing through ear-acupressure and essential oils
  6. Preventive maintenance for aging and skin blemishes

In this course you will learn:

  1. The causes of skin diseases and aging according to the Chinese Medicine Model
  2. 12 soft-tissue strokes for rejuvenation and prevention of aging
  3. The function of acupressure points, their location and evaluation on the ears, face, head and neck
  4. Special uses of essential oils for the face with special application techniques to the ears
  5. Facial skin-lift Qigong exercises

This workshop focuses on three interrelated phases and stages:

  • Active Cancer Stage
  • Post Treatment Phase
  • Surviving phase with remission stage

Introduction:  Cancer in its many variations (over 200 types have been identified) and treatments affect all clients in a holistic manner.  Body-Mind and Spirit are inextricably woven together and no one body part should be ignored. Cancer is systemic and long term. There is no single cause of cancer, like a virus, microbe or bacteria. Cancer is slow-acting and insidious. Therefore, the instructor has chosen three ancient, time-proven and modern bodywork modalities that work synergistically to create a healing environment in the client.  Also, none of these modalities are invasive or confrontational.

Protocol:  According to Traditional Chinese Medicine, when the Qi is blocked and stagnant, there is dis-ease. The goal is to create a balanced and free flow of Qi. The quickest way to access the Qi is through these four modalities:  Meditation, Acupressure, Reflexology and Manual Lymphatic Drainage.  The student will also learn to use ancient Gusa Sha tools for scar tissue release, stagnate Qi and blood flow, Trigger Points and more.

In addition, you will be taught the appropriate level of Touch/Pressure, contraindications and precautions and the best positioning for the client receiving. You will also discuss the three main current medical therapies and their side-effects: Chemotherapy, Radiation and Surgery.

Even if you have never treated clients with cancer, this workshop will be useful because it focuses on the IMMUNE system and any imbalances in health caused by Myofascial pain and emotional stress.  This workshop is excellent for post Covid survivors and should be seen as preventive as well.

This is a forty-two hour course of training in which the students refine their skills of palpation while learning the ten-step protocol of craniosacral therapy (Hugh Milne approach with some Upledger), myofascial release, advanced unwinding, and somato-emotional release.

Course Description: Craniosacral therapy is a subtle intent approach to releasing and balancing physical, emotional and somatic imbalance within the body. On the physical level, it focuses on releasing restrictions in the fascia of the abdominal, diaphragm and chest segments, and restrictions in the reciprocal tension membrane lining the skull and the spinal column, to normalize the volume, flow, and movement of cerebral-spinal fluid within the system. Although the movements employed are quite subtle, and the pressure of the work is delicate, the results can be profound in the treatment of a range of injuries and chronic conditions including headaches, neck pain, sinus headaches and chronic congestion, and back and hip problems, among many others.

The work is performed on clothed clients, and is very powerful in addressing touch issues for clients who are recovering from trauma or abuse. The energetics of intention and presence are stressed, since the somatic-emotional connection is central to the work.

This law and ethics class is designed for the working massage and bodywork professional.  The orientation of the class is to develop an understanding of ethical issues in a working practice, and, where necessary, to manage any conflict between the personal ethics of a therapist, the national standards of the bodywork profession as they are outlined by various trade organizations, and legal parameters of practice as they might apply to four main areas:

  • Required Curriculum for Tennessee Massage Law Continuing Education Courses and Massage School Instruction
  • Business Practices
  • Dual Relationships
  • Sexuality

No Prerequisites.  This class is designed to teach you to move stagnate lymph to boost the immune system, clean sinus, reduce swelling, increase circulation and speed healing.

The entire Lymphatic system will be addressed within this class. It is a nurturing and relaxing massage for those who may not be able to tolerate deep pressure. Head, Neck & Brain work is the basis for all Lymphatic Drainage and can be easily integrated with other modalities.

Real success in massage therapy, or any method of hands-on healing, depends largely on your mastery of mindfulness and palpation. This two-day class blends lecture, discussion and guided exercises with plenty of hands-on practice to refine your sense of touch. On the first day, working with inanimate objects and living tissues, we adopt strategies from world-renowned educators to increase sensitivity and awareness. Then we will use our newly enhanced abilities to evaluate the cardiac pulse and respiratory movements for signs of dysfunction, pathology, and nervous system activation. On the second day, our examination of skin, fascia and muscles will flow seamlessly into treatment with results that will boost your confidence as a therapist. Our goal is not to add to your knowledge but rather to transform your practice.

After taking this class, students will be able to:

  • Discuss anatomy and physiology of touch
  • Discuss the importance of verbal description in palpation
  • Describe techniques to develop and enhance palpatory skills
  • Evaluate the level of nervous system activation through touch
  • Demonstrate specific techniques for assessing and treating fascia
  • Palpate and evaluate the cardiac pulse and respiratory movements
  • Discuss skin temperature and its role in assessment
  • Evaluate musle tone and muscle function
  • Discuss the importance of "end-feel"
  • Evaluate joint health and range of motion
